In most cases, machines need 135 x 17 needles but use your manual to find exactly the needle system you need. Alternatively, you can also search for the needles compatible with the model of your sewing machine on google 2: I suggest a standard universal needle because it is suitable for all situations. Also known as R-point. 3: The size of your needle depends on 2 things: you want to poke the smallest hole through your material as you can but it still has to do 2 things. It still needs to fit the thread through that needle without breaking the thread and it needs to be strong enough to sew through the material without breaking. I sugest starting out with size 18, 20 and 22. 4: For the thread: 95% of the time, I use the size 92 bonded polyester
